Read News, Ask, Comment, Discuss

Current Challenges




Database Home

Browse Gene Pools

Submit Genotype

Copyright © 2000−2024 M.K.

 
Advanced
 

Genotype details

Name: Worm
From gene pool: solid-shapes
Author: Szymon Ulatowski
Date submitted: 2015-09-23
Size: 21 parts
20 joints
0 neurons
0 neural connections
Actions: Download this genotype

Description: A worm with pseudoreticulopodium.
How created: Designed
This is the output from part_shapes.cpp – a demo application showing how to build a model algorithmically using the SDK API.
http://framsticks.com/trac/framsticks/browser/cpp/frams/_demos/part_shapes.cpp
Chain of ellipsoids – subsequent parts are placed relative to the previous part's orientation and location.
Chain of cylinders – line segments between points calculated from parametric formula (halfcircle).
Performance notes:
Full genotype:
//0
p:sh
=1, sy=0.7, sz=0.4
p:1.0,
sh=1, sx=0.9, sy=0.63, sz=0.36, rx=0.1, 0.2, 0.3
p:1.84266402722578, 0.260666529862964, 0.178802397715555,
sh=1, sx=0.81, sy=0.567, sz=0.324, rx=0.138086690197694, 0.420358252928712, 0.598344380796097
p:2.45367669219348, 0.677199384388839, 0.50935330809034,
sh=1, sx=0.729, sy=0.5103, sz=0.2916, rx=0.0993189916818848, 0.641169665568855, 0.92813208949765
p:2.8038163494411, 1.14486711987127, 0.945392422862456,
sh=1, sx=0.6561, sy=0.45927, sz=0.26244, rx=-0.0508678834140358, 0.835260537240566, 1.33982641068808
p:2.90459526396592, 1.57340960039436, 1.4318717777937,
sh=1, sx=0.59049, sy=0.413343, sz=0.236196, rx=-0.352304612583367, 0.957030831242344, 1.88639787543986
p:2.79903448361997, 1.89670495358329, 1.9145885439819,
sh=1, sx=0.531441, sy=0.3720087, sz=0.2125764, rx=-0.740533687707318, 0.95314532014898, 2.51470442964324
p:2.54978560150784, 2.07725074442088, 2.34784106694938,
sh=1, sx=0.4782969, sy=0.33480783, sz=0.19131876, rx=-1.03347250421838, 0.825758190613796, 3.05338513415861
p:2.22676112181543, 2.10581806091781, 2.69941896514154,
sh=1, sx=0.43046721, sy=0.301327047, sz=0.172186884, rx=-1.1761487722698, 0.629178175749304, -2.82433170553136
p:1.89609282270862, 1.99724236348662, 2.95274052517607,
sh=1, sx=0.387420489, sy=0.2711943423, sz=0.1549681956, rx=-1.20990508395417, 0.407788137330923, -2.49745734998435
p:1.61170652763811, 1.78367070130281, 3.10638366880803,
sh=1, sx=0.3486784401, sy=0.24407490807, sz=0.13947137604, rx=-1.16809091229628, 0.188068474228345, -2.19976583294922
p:0.0489434864063589,
z=0.309017002689348, sh=3, sx=0.312868938715108, sy=0.05, sz=0.05, rx=-1.54602460841747, 1.41371668974427
p:0.239926502308576,
z=0.896802269127124, sh=3, sx=0.312868938715108, sy=0.05, sz=0.05, rx=-1.34347487976637, 1.09955741564301
p:0.603197784827698,
z=1.39680227622847, sh=3, sx=0.312868938715108, sy=0.05, sz=0.05, rx=-0.955316587215889, 0.785398141541753
p:1.10319780780814,
z=1.7600735368919, sh=3, sx=0.312868938715108, sy=0.05, sz=0.05, rx=-0.51946655859979, 0.471238867440496
p:1.69098308259404,
z=1.9510565271012, sh=3, sx=0.312868938715108, sy=0.05, sz=0.05, rx=-0.159004970048235, 0.157079593339238
p:2.30901708797274,
z=1.95105650008608, sh=3, sx=0.312868938715108, sy=0.05, sz=0.05, rx=0.159005060671175, -0.157079680762018
p:2.89680224962004,
z=1.76007352856041, sh=3, sx=0.312868820973482, sy=0.05, sz=0.05, rx=0.519466594343112, -0.471238895258631
p:3.39680210070336,
z=1.39680241707027, sh=3, sx=0.312868820973482, sy=0.05, sz=0.05, rx=0.955316457969276, -0.785398050150599
p:3.76007332544031,
z=0.896802648265582, sh=3, sx=0.312868820973482, sy=0.05, sz=0.05, rx=1.34347467469612, -1.09955720504257
p:3.95105643009556,
z=0.309017649084024, sh=3, sx=0.312868820973482, sy=0.05, sz=0.05, rx=1.54602450399998, -1.41371635993453
j:0, 1,
sh=1
j:1, 2,
sh=1
j:2, 3,
sh=1
j:3, 4,
sh=1
j:4, 5,
sh=1
j:5, 6,
sh=1
j:6, 7,
sh=1
j:7, 8,
sh=1
j:8, 9,
sh=1
j:9, 10,
sh=1
j:10, 11,
sh=1
j:11, 12,
sh=1
j:12, 13,
sh=1
j:13, 14,
sh=1
j:14, 15,
sh=1
j:15, 16,
sh=1
j:16, 17,
sh=1
j:17, 18,
sh=1
j:18, 19,
sh=1
j:19, 20,
sh=1

Height on land (MS): -0.01905
 
 
Height on land (ODE): 0.7726
 
 
Land speed (ODE): 0